# Outbound campaigns

> Configure, schedule, and control outbound calling campaigns.

Campaigns use an agent, phone number, and contact groups to place outbound calls.

## Create a campaign

<Steps>
  <Step title="Add basic details">
    Open **Campaigns**, select **New campaign**, and enter a campaign name. Select a phone number that has the intended outbound agent assigned.
  </Step>

  <Step title="Set concurrency">
    Choose how many calls the campaign can make concurrently. Use a level your workflow and connected services can support.
  </Step>

  <Step title="Choose audiences">
    Add at least one contact group. Include the DND groups that apply to the campaign.
  </Step>

  <Step title="Choose a schedule">
    Start immediately or choose a start date and time. For a scheduled window, set its start, end, and repeat days.
  </Step>

  <Step title="Review and launch">
    Review the reach analysis, then confirm the agent, phone number, included and excluded audiences, schedule, and concurrency before you start or schedule the campaign.
  </Step>
</Steps>

## Control a campaign

The campaign list shows its current state. Depending on that state, you can start, pause, resume, or cancel the campaign. A campaign can move through states including draft, scheduled, running, paused, completed, cancelled, failed, or stopped.

Open campaign details to review total contacts and call progress, including pending, queued, dialing, answered, and failed attempts.

Edit a campaign only when its current state allows configuration changes. Pausing stops new campaign work while preserving progress; cancelling ends the campaign lifecycle.
